题目描述

$XHM$喜欢吃西瓜。但是他喜欢掰别人家的西瓜。

在XHM印度的家的旁边,有很多农户农田排成一排,他们家里都栽种了西瓜。一共有$n$个农户,他们分别在这一排距离XHM家$d_i$的距离。现在,XHM要选择其中$m$个农户偷西瓜。

当然,农户会检查自己有没有被偷瓜。具体方法是:如果相邻距离小于等于$dis$的两户同时被偷瓜,他们就会知道自己被偷瓜,然后通知新德里PD,把XHM抓起来。

XHM很慌,想让你算算他会不会被新德里PD请去喝茶。存不存在一种可能性,他能不去新德里PD喝茶呢?

注意,这不是贪心题。


输入格式

第一行输入$n,m,dis$ $(1 \leq n,m \leq 10^6, 1\leq dis \leq 10^7)$。

第二行输入$n$个数字,代表$d_i$ $(1 \leq d_i \leq 10^7)$。两两农户距离XHM距离各不相同。


输出格式

第一行输出判断。如果他要去新德里PD喝茶,输出"XHM BBQ";如果他不用去新德里PD喝茶,输出"DELHI BBQ"。

第二行无论成功与否,都要输出偷了m个瓜后,最大的最小的同时被偷瓜的相邻两户的距离,这样方便下次作案。


样例数据

输入

第一组样例:
5 3 1
1 2 3 4 5

第二组样例:
5 3 3
1 4 7 8 10

输出

第一组样例:
DELHI BBQ
2

第二组样例:
XHM BBQ
3

备注


操作

评测记录

优秀代码

信息

时间限制: 1s
内存限制: 128MB
评测模式: Normal

题解